## Sensor drift: what to do at 3am

If the GrowLoop controller starts reporting humidity swings that don't match the backup probes in the Fernwick greenhouse, it's almost always sensor drift, not an actual climate event. Don't panic and don't touch the vents manually. First, restart the calibration daemon and give it ten minutes to re-baseline. If readings still disagree by more than 5%, flip the controller into safe mode. The safe-mode thresholds it will use are these.

config for yahap-bajof:
[istix]
host = istix.qorvelsys.internal
user = istix_svc
database = istix_prod

Excerpt — ProctorQueue v2 (Veldt Academy platform). Candidates enter a single FIFO queue per exam window; proctors claim sessions via lease. Leases expire if heartbeats stop, returning the candidate to the head of the queue. Overflow beyond proctor capacity triggers a waitlist with estimated-wait messaging. No priority tiers in v2; fairness over speed. Scaling is horizontal on queue shards only. Tuning constants for lease, heartbeat, and overflow behavior are listed below.

tuning constants:
RATE_LIMITS = {
    "wenwyn": 1,
    "zorix": 10,
    "oliix": 2,
    "holael": 10,
}

## Deploying the Gatewick Proctor Queue

Deploys are pretty painless: push to main, wait for the pipeline, then watch the queue drain dashboard for five minutes. If candidates pile up mid-exam, roll back first and ask questions later — the queue replays safely. Everything the workers care about lives in one config block, shown here for reference.

settings of bafof-yagef:
JOROX_PIN=8740
JOROX_TENANT=pelox
JOROX_METRICS_HOST=metrics.jorox.qorvelworks.internal
JOROX_SEAL=seal_c78f63c1
JOROX_STANDBY_TEAM=norax

14:22 — Offline sync regression confirmed (Terrapath field-survey app)

At 14:22 the on-call engineer reproduced the data-loss path: surveys saved while offline were marked synced once connectivity returned, even when the upload was rejected. The queue flush skipped the server acknowledgement check introduced in the previous sprint. Release manager note: the fix must ship before the coastal survey season. The offending build is identified by the token recorded below.

session token of kawif-fawig = htk31_f3f599be2b1a34affb1efa8d0feccf8